The cheapest way to get from Jerusalem to Mykonos is to train and fly which costs €130 - €400 and takes 4h 50m.
The fastest way to get from Jerusalem to Mykonos is to train and fly which takes 4h 50m and costs €130 - €400.
The distance between Jerusalem and Mykonos is 1104 km.
It takes approximately 4h 50m to get from Jerusalem to Mykonos, including transfers.

There is no direct connection from Jerusalem to Mykonos. However, you can take the train to נתב''ג, walk to Ben Gurion Airport (TLV) airport, fly to Mykonos (JMK), walk to Mykonos Airport, then take the bus to Mykonos Fabrika Square.
